Certification Exam Name: Versa Certified SSE Associate (VNX125)

This specialized level exam is intended for engineers who design, optimize performance of, administer, manage, troubleshoot, and support Security Services Edge, or SSE services, on Versa Networks platforms.

Scope of Certification

Cloud based security functions and services

Understanding of services, architectures, and features/functions of the Versa Networks cloud based security implementation.

Knowledge of the monitoring and reporting capabilities provide by the Versa SASE Portal

Recommended Knowledge and Experience

You can prepare for certification exams with the materials available on the Versa Academy. The following sources are recommended, but not required, for study:
  • Versa Essentials
  • Versa SASE Essentials
  • 3-6 months of hands-on administrative, design and troubleshooting experience in Versa Secure SD-WAN platform
  • Industry and product knowledge of WAN and SD-WAN technologies
  • Versa technical publications

Versa Certification Badges

Versa has partnered with Credly’s Acclaim platform to award badges for your certification achievements. Digital credentials go beyond paper certificates. They are portable, verifiable, and uniquely linked to you. When someone views your badge, they can learn more about your skills and verify the badge’s authenticity—ensuring only you can take credit for your skills.

How it works

  1. You will receive an email notifying you to claim your badge
  2. Click the link in that email.
  3. Create an account on the Acclaim site and confirm your email.
  4. Claim your badge.
  5. Start sharing.
After you have passed your certification exam, you can download your certificate from the Acclaim web site (certificates are NOT automatically sent to you).

Certificate Validity

Versa Certifications are valid for two years. To maintain your Versa Certified status, we require you to periodically demonstrate your continued expertise though recertification. Certification status can be maintained by taking the same or higher level exam
